Krakow Poland

 

Krakow Poland is a lovely city of around 800,000 inhabitants. The Wawel royal castle (pic above) is stunning, the grounds are open to the public, exhibits cost€. We travelled by train to Krakow from Berlin and stayed 3 nights. We spent time exploring the old town area, markets and the castle. We did a day trip tour to Auschwitz and a salt mine which I’ll post about in the next blog.
